Let’s cut to the chase: cutting glass bottle weight isn’t just about saving shipping costs—it’s about sustainability, carbon footprint reduction, and smarter manufacturing. Over the past decade, leading beverage brands (Coca-Cola, Heineken, San Pellegrino) have reduced average bottle weight by 12–18% without sacrificing drop resistance or internal pressure performance.

How? It starts with *precision engineering*, not guesswork. Modern lightweighting relies on three pillars: optimized geometry (especially base and shoulder design), advanced cullet blending (≥70% recycled content improves melt homogeneity), and real-time hot-end inspection using AI-powered vision systems.
Here’s what the data shows across 42 production lines audited in 2023–2024:
| Strategy | Avg. Weight Reduction | Impact on Breakage Rate (% Δ) | CO₂ Saved per 1M Units (kg) |
|---|---|---|---|
| Shoulder profile optimization | 6.2% | +0.3 | 1,840 |
| Base ring redesign + annealing tune | 9.7% | −0.1 | 2,910 |
| High-purity cullet + O₂-enriched combustion | 5.1% | +0.05 | 1,420 |
| Combined approach (all three) | 14.3% | −0.02 | 4,380 |
Note: Breakage rate changes are relative to baseline (100% virgin batch, legacy tooling). Negative values mean *improved* reliability—yes, lighter can be stronger when physics and process sync up.
Crucially, ASTM C1421-22 and ISO 7458 compliance must be verified *per batch*, not just per design. We recommend dynamic load testing at ≥120 drops (not just 3–5) using calibrated steel anvils—and always test filled, capped units under simulated transport vibration (ASTM D4728).
One underrated lever? Mold cooling uniformity. A 3°C variance across mold zones increases wall-thickness deviation by up to 23%, directly undermining lightweighting gains. Infrared thermography mapping during pilot runs catches this early.
